What is Electrical Engineering?
Electrical engineering is the branch of engineering that deals with the study and application of electricity, electronics, and electromagnetism. It covers everything from power generation and transmission to electronics design and automation.

Latest Tools and Software You Should Know
Software | Use |
---|---|
MATLAB | Simulation & Data Analysis |
AutoCAD | Circuit and Layout Designing |
ETAP | Power System Modeling |
Multisim | Circuit Design and Simulation |
LabVIEW | Test & Measurement Systems |

FAQs
โ What does an aspiring electrical engineer do?
They study, practice, and work on electrical systems and devices while preparing to become licensed professionals.
โ How long does it take to become an electrical engineer?
Typically 4 years for a bachelor’s degree, with optional 2-4 years for advanced degrees or certifications.
โ Is electrical engineering hard?
It’s challenging but rewarding. With dedication and curiosity, anyone can master the field.
โ Can I work abroad as an electrical engineer?
Yes, electrical engineers are in demand globally. Many countries recognize ABET or similar certifications.
โ What are some famous projects by electrical engineers?
Power plants, electric vehicles, smart homes, space satellites, and medical equipment design are a few.
